Courses
Courses for Kids
Free study material
Offline Centres
More
Store Icon
Store

Video Game Genres Explained for Kids: A Coding Guide

share icon
share icon
banner

Which Video Game Genre Should Kids Choose to Start Coding?

Video game genres are like the building blocks of every game your child loves to play or create! Knowing the different types helps kids and parents understand what makes a game fun, educational, or safe. In this friendly guide, we explain video game genres, share examples, and give tips to help your child explore coding, learning, and creativity safely online.


What Are Video Game Genres? Explained for Kids

Video game genres are groups of games with similar stories, goals, or ways to play. For example, adventure games focus on exploration, while racing games are all about speed. Understanding video game genres helps parents and kids pick the right games and even inspires new ideas for coding projects.


  • Each genre comes with unique game mechanics and skills to learn.

  • Subgenres provide even more specific experiences and challenges.

  • Knowing these genres is great for coding your own games in Scratch or Python!


Explore more Coding for Kids topics

Video Game Genres List: Main Categories and Subgenres

Genre What It Means Popular Examples
Action Fast-paced; testing reflexes, timing, and hand-eye coordination. Super Mario Bros., Sonic the Hedgehog
Adventure Story-driven; focuses on exploration and solving puzzles. Minecraft, The Legend of Zelda
Role-Playing Games (RPGs) Players take on character roles, grow skills, and make choices. Pokémon, Final Fantasy
Puzzle Logic and problem-solving games for all ages. Tetris, Candy Crush Saga
Simulation Real-life activities like building, flying, or running a business. The Sims, SimCity
Strategy Planning, managing resources, and outsmarting opponents. Chess, Plants vs. Zombies
Sports & Racing Mimics real-world sports or racing in exciting ways. FIFA, Mario Kart
Fighting Two or more characters battle using combos or special moves. Street Fighter, Super Smash Bros.
Casual Easy to start, fun in short play sessions—great for everyone! Angry Birds, Flappy Bird

The video game genres list above can jumpstart creative ideas for kids to code their own games and understand what makes play fun and safe. Exploring many genres helps develop critical thinking, logic, and problem-solving skills.


Popular Video Game Genres and Subgenres Explained

Let’s look at each main genre, discover subgenres, and find real examples. These explanations will help you learn how to make your own video game or pick the best ones to play and code with your family.


Action Games

Action games are fast-paced and great for improving reflexes. Subgenres include platformers (jumping, climbing), shooters, fighting, and beat 'em ups. Games like Sonic the Hedgehog or Minecraft’s Adventure mode let kids practice quick thinking and precise movements.


Adventure Games

Adventure games tell engaging stories. Players solve puzzles, talk to characters, and explore new worlds. Subgenres include point-and-click adventures and interactive fiction. A game like The Legend of Zelda or Scratch story games inspires young coders to use creative storytelling in their projects.


Learn to animate your own adventures!

Role-Playing Games (RPGs)

In RPGs, you create a character, explore worlds, and complete quests. Subgenres range from action RPGs (real-time battles) to turn-based or tactical RPGs (careful planning needed). Games like Pokémon and Dragon Quest teach decision-making, resource management, and planning.


Try coding a simple RPG in Scratch

Puzzle Games

Puzzle games challenge logic and pattern spotting. Types include tile-matching (Candy Crush), word games, and brain teasers. These games help boost problem-solving skills and are perfect for young coders to recreate or remix in Scratch or Python.


Make your own puzzle game with Python!

Simulation Games

Simulation games mimic real-life activities. Kids can build a city (SimCity), create a family (The Sims), or fly a plane. Subgenres include management simulators and creative building games like Minecraft. These games support strategic thinking and creativity.


Strategy Games

Kids who love planning and making choices will enjoy strategy games. They include real-time strategy (RTS) like Clash of Clans and tower defense games like Plants vs. Zombies. These games improve foresight, patience, and logical thinking.


Start simple coding projects on strategy games

Sports and Racing Games

Sports games like FIFA or Mario Kart focus on friendly competition, speed, and teamwork. Racing games teach about physics, quick reactions, and timing. These are ideal for short fun sessions with friends or family.


Fighting Games

Fighting games let players compete in fast, skill-based matches (e.g., Street Fighter, Super Smash Bros.). Movements, combos, and practice help players improve. Coding a fighting game in Scratch is a great beginner challenge for kids!


Tutorial for Scratch fighting games

Casual Games and Party Games

These games are easy to pick up and fun to share. Popular titles like Angry Birds, Flappy Bird, and party games inspire creativity, quick play, and friendly competition. These are perfect first-games for new coders to recreate.


Video Game Genres and Digital Literacy for Kids

Exploring video game genres with examples is more than just play—it's a chance for kids to build safe online habits. Parents should discuss online safety, age-appropriate content, and encourage positive screen time. Building games with Scratch or Python nurtures critical thinking, digital literacy, and confidence in coding for kids.


  • Talk as a family about which genres suit your child's age.

  • Encourage kids to remix or build their favorite games with safe, child-friendly tools like Scratch.

  • Teach kids about balancing play, learning, and online kindness.


Discover coding apps for safe learning

Video Game Genres Project Ideas for Kids

Kids can learn coding by making simple games in genres they already love. Here are fun project ideas that support hands-on learning and creativity:


  • Create a maze (puzzle genre) in Scratch for friends to solve.

  • Build a racing game in Python, learning about speed and timing.

  • Remake a favorite platformer with new levels and characters.

  • Invent a role-playing game story, then code the quest using branching paths.


Find more coding game ideas for kids

Tips for Parents: Supporting Safe Play in Video Game Genres

Help your child explore new games by staying involved and encouraging coding in a safe, structured way. Choosing games by genre helps you set expectations and avoid inappropriate experiences. Try learning with them—making your own simple game or story in Scratch is a wonderful way to connect!


  • Check age ratings and talk about online safety for each genre.

  • Set daily screen time limits for different types of games.

  • Use platforms like Scratch for safe, creative, and social coding fun.

  • Encourage group coding or playing for teamwork and social skills.


Explore Scratch coding for beginners

How Video Game Genres Inspire Coding Skills

Learning about video game genres and subgenres lets children not only enjoy playing, but also inspires them to code their own projects. By understanding what makes each genre special—like puzzles, action, or strategy—kids can build games that challenge, teach, or tell fun stories. Vedantu’s courses help kids turn gaming passion into real coding abilities!


Get started coding your favorite genre!

Page Summary

Video game genres help families choose, enjoy, and create games together. Each genre offers unique ways to play, learn to code, and express creativity. By discovering video game genres with examples, kids become smarter digital citizens and budding coders. Explore more with Vedantu to find the perfect fit for your child’s learning and playing journey!

Want to read offline? download full PDF here
Download full PDF
Is this page helpful?
like-imagedislike-image

FAQs on Video Game Genres Explained for Kids: A Coding Guide

1. What are the main types of video games?

The main types of video games for kids include several key genres that teach different coding and thinking skills. Popular genres are:

  • Action: Fast-paced, requiring timing and coordination
  • Adventure: Story-based and exploration-driven
  • Puzzle: Focused on logic, problem-solving, and critical thinking
  • Simulation: Mimicking real-world activities
  • Racing: Speed and reflex-oriented
  • Platformer: Jumping and navigation challenges
Learning about these game genres helps children select, create, and understand coding projects in alignment with CBSE/ICSE/IGCSE computer science topics.

2. What is the difference between a puzzle game and an action game?

Puzzle games require logical thinking and problem-solving, while action games focus on quick reactions and movement. Key differences include:

  • Puzzle games: Encourage critical thinking, sequencing, and pattern recognition (e.g., matching games, mazes).
  • Action games: Build hand-eye coordination and timing (e.g., platformers, shooting games).
Both genres are vital for learning coding basics and creative thinking as per school curricula.

3. Can kids make their own video games?

Yes, children can create their own video games using easy, safe coding platforms designed for their age and learning level. Platforms include:

  • Scratch: Block-based, visual coding – ideal for beginners (ages 7+)
  • Roblox: Lua coding for interactive 3D games (ages 9+)
  • code.org: Guided tutorials for various game genres
Building games helps students develop creativity, coding skills, and project confidence, directly supporting CBSE, ICSE, and IGCSE computer science requirements.

4. Which coding games are suitable for beginners?

Beginners should start with coding games that are simple, interactive, and visual. Good options are:

  • Puzzle games: Encourages logic and sequencing (e.g., Scratch Maze, code.org puzzles)
  • Platformer games: Teaches movement logic and event handling
  • Racing games: Simple to code, focuses on variables and scores
These game types introduce block-based coding aligned with early STEM and school computer science learning.

5. How can understanding game genres help in school computer projects or coding competitions?

Knowing video game genres helps students pick the suitable project and demonstrate key skills in school assignments and Olympiads by:

  • Selecting age-appropriate, curriculum-aligned games to code
  • Connecting genre features to coding concepts like logic, variables, and loops
  • Standing out in STEM and school coding competitions with creative, syllabus-based projects
This approach strengthens exam performance and builds real-world skills.

6. Are there safe, child-friendly platforms to explore different game genres?

Yes, safe platforms like Scratch, code.org, and Roblox offer child-friendly environments with built-in safety features. For example:

  • Scratch: Moderated community, parental guides, and block-based coding
  • Roblox: Parental controls and private games for kids 9+
  • code.org: Teacher-led courses with monitored gameplay
These platforms align with CBSE and global coding curriculum standards.

7. Which genre should my child start with to make their first game: action, puzzle, or something else?

Puzzle and platformer genres are ideal for beginners because they teach fundamental coding concepts, problem-solving, and logic. Suggestions include:

  • Puzzle games: Start here for logic and sequencing
  • Platformer games: Good for practicing movement and events
  • Racing games: Fun way to learn about variables and scores
These genres are syllabus-friendly and suitable for primary and middle school projects.

8. What skills do kids learn by making different types of coding games?

Creating coding games helps children build a range of practical and academic skills:

  • Logic and problem-solving (puzzle and maze games)
  • Creativity and storytelling (adventure games)
  • Hand-eye coordination (action and racing games)
  • Understanding variables, events, and loops (all genres)
These skills match the STEM competencies required by school boards like CBSE, ICSE, and IGCSE.

9. What are the best game genres to code for beginners?

The best game genres for coding beginners are ones that are simple, fun, and allow students to see results quickly, such as:

  • Puzzle games: Easy logic and structure
  • Platformers: Basic movement and event triggers
  • Racing games: Fast feedback, reinforces scoring logic
These genres help children grasp core programming ideas from the CBSE and IGCSE syllabi.

10. What is video game genre in simple words?

Video game genre means the type or style of a game based on its rules, gameplay, and goals. For example:

  • Puzzle genre: Focuses on solving problems
  • Action genre: Requires quick moves
  • Simulation genre: Mimics real-life activities
Knowing genres helps kids pick, learn, and build games in line with school computer science topics.

11. Which video game genres are commonly used in Scratch and Roblox?

Scratch is often used for puzzle, platformer, and adventure games, while Roblox is popular for adventure, racing, and RPG genres. Both let students code their own game projects that match school curriculum skills and interests.